Abstract

Reports on the Illinois Library Computer Systems Organization (ILCSO) assessment methodology task force’s work in determining their assessment formulae for the decade covering ten fiscal years, 1988‐1999. The article includes the rationale ILCSO used for membership assessments, assessment totals by fiscal year, assessment methodologies by fiscal year, new member assessments and an appendix detailing the cost allocation methodologies used by 21 other consortia.
